Flowserve vs MOGAS Industries: what is the difference?

Flowserve (USA (Irving, Texas), est. 1997 (merger origin)) is known for Extensive valve portfolio - control valves, severe service, nuclear, Durco chemical, Vogt instrumentation. MOGAS Industries (USA, est. 1973) is known for Severe service ball valves - FCC, coker, thermal cracking, abrasive and erosive service. They overlap most in ball valves, gate valves.
